To: Executive Team (Board copied)
Subject: Term sheet from Corvalline Partners

All — Corvalline's term sheet arrived yesterday. Headline terms: minority stake, one board observer seat, and milestone-based tranches tied to the Ashfell rollout. Valuation is within our modelled range. Legal review completes Friday; no red flags so far. The strategic context we discussed is summarised directly below.

board note of kageg-bahof: The renewal with Holwynax Holdings closes at $2 million a year, 5 percent below the last contract. Project Ulaath slips by two quarters because of the supplier delay.

Subject: Quickstore 4.2 — bloom filter now fronts the KV layer

Plugin authors: starting with this release, Quickstore places a bloom filter ahead of the key-value store. Negative lookups return faster; false positives fall through safely. No API changes are required on your side. Verify your plugin against the staging build referenced below.

session token of fahif-tadup = htk3_9c7

## Deployment

The Farrowline rules engine computes shipping fees for all Bexton storefronts. It deploys as a single service; rule packs are versioned separately and loaded at startup, so a config change usually means a restart rather than a rebuild. Canary one instance before rolling the fleet, since bad rule packs fail loudly. The engine expects the following configuration values.

deployment values, tagug-tagaf:
[zorix]
team = druix
access_code = ac_42e3e2
host = zorix.qirvancorp.test
port = 6379
owner = beldor.gordor
peer = kelath.zemvarcorp.test

Hi Tomas, Handing over the Fernspout watering scheduler release duties while I'm out. Builds run nightly from the Mosswick pipeline; promote to production only after the soil-sensor smoke tests pass. Release notes live in the shared Dapplegate folder. To sign the release manifest before promotion, use the key that follows below.

rollout seal: bky4_x7Gc

Subject: cron drift — found the culprit (mostly)

Hey folks, quick update on the Brindlewood scheduler drift. Turns out the Fenwick batch host was syncing time against a decommissioned Kestrel node, so jobs crept about 40 seconds per day until the 02:00 rollups started landing in the wrong window. I've repointed it and added an alert if skew passes 5s. Keep an eye on tonight's run — if the digest emails land on time, we're good. The fix shipped in the build noted below.

session token of hawif-bajog = htk6_9ab8da